ABSTRACT
BACKGROUND:
Situations considered disasters have become increasingly frequent worldwide. Response actions include the health sector, and access to blood and blood products is essential for the functioning of health services. This study aims to map research on the responses of hemotherapy services (blood collection and/or transfusion units) to emergency situations, disasters, and conflicts in different countries around the world.
METHODS:
This is a review study that adopted inclusion and exclusion criteria, with a temporal scope covering studies published from 2005 to 2023, based on searches conducted in the PubMed, Scielo, and CAPES Theses Database. The Rayyan platform was used to support the screening and organization of studies, along with Microsoft Excel for data organization.
RESULTS:
A total of 37 studies from several countries - such as the United States, Brazil, France, England, Japan, among others - were selected and analyzed. The following thematic categories were identified: “blood and supply stock management”, “infrastructure and facilities”, “collaboration between blood centers and hospitals in the distribution of blood components”, “safety measures for donors and healthcare professionals”, “donor recruitment strategies” and “other measures”. These categories group the main mechanisms used by some countries to maintain the supply of therapeutic resources, particularly blood, in the face of emergency situations, disasters, and conflicts.
CONCLUSIONS:
Countries have developed various hemotherapy service responses to emergency situations, disasters, and conflicts. The strategies adopted show that although blood shortages are a common problem in these contexts, different measures are required, highlighting the importance of planning for service organization and resource allocation.
